Fissure sealant and fluoride application are the most effective preventive practices to prevent tooth decay in children. These practices should be supported by good oral health habits, especially during the growth period.
- Fissure sealant: The grooves of the back teeth are closed
- Fluoride varnish/gel: Enamel is strengthened
- Nutrition counseling
- Brushing technique training
Who is it suitable for?
- Children with high risk of caries
- Children with erupted rear molars

From what age is it applied?
When the first permanent molars erupt at the age of 6, fissure sealant can be planned; Fluoride can be started at an earlier age.
